LLoyds Online Loan Offers
Hi everybody,
I bank with lloyds bank, Ive been banking with them for 8 years now, I was checking my account online, and I went to the loan page to check my quotations, the result was a range of quotations with APRs between 12.9% and 16.9%. As I know 29.9% means an absolute decline, does this mean that I am pre approved for this rate ?
I have no debt issues, no outstanding debts, two sub prime credit cards paid in full, I earn £28k, paid into my lloyds account on weekly basis, but not as BACs payment. Also I'm 25, so my credit history isn't that old.
thank you

Not necessarily. It just means they may be prepared to lend to you at the rate based on what they know about you.
But the outcome could be different once they have run a full credit check and asked your income, etc.0 -

Umm its AIP, so surely that's a soft search?
Will be interesting to see what the eventual rate offered is.0 -
Umm its AIP, so surely that's a soft search?
Will be interesting to see what the eventual rate offered is.
It is a soft search but once you are given the APR you are asked if you want to proceed with the application and warned that a full hard search will a be carried out.
The APR you are given after the soft search is the APR that will be documented on the credit agreement.0 -
